Abstract: Plaque inscription: The building is dedicated by Mrs. Lizzie White Hood, of Nashville, Tennessee. In memory of her beloved brother Gordon White, D.D.S. (1858-1916). A pioneer in the field of dental science, he won international distinction by the invention of instruments and the development of treatments and techniques, which he generously made available to the members of his profession.Widely cultured, attractive, benevolent, he exemplified the finest ideals if professional integrity and Christian citizenship.
